Cost of Living
Sharjah City is the more affordable option overall — monthly living expenses run approximately
10% lower compared to Rexburg.
Housing costs are a major driver: Sharjah City's average rent is
16% lower than Rexburg's.
| Metric | Sharjah City | Rexburg | Diff |
|---|---|---|---|
| Average Rent | $882 | $1,044 | -16% |
| Groceries | $327 | $262 | +25% |
| Utilities | $270 | $180 | +50% |
| Transport | $68 | $150 | -55% |
| Healthcare | $150 | $250 | -40% |
| Monthly Total | $1,697 | $1,886 | -10% |
| Cost Index | 50 | 116 | out of 100 |

Pros & Cons
Sharjah City
Advantages
Sharjah offers a more affordable cost of living compared to neighboring Dubai, particularly in terms of accommodation.
The city is consistently ranked among the safest globally, with a high safety index score of 84.5 in January 2026.
Sharjah's economy is experiencing strong growth, with a 45% increase in new jobs created in H1 2025 and a 14% rise in new business registrations in 2025.
The healthcare system provides quality medical services with 10 hospitals and medical centers, and the UAE ranks highly in global healthcare quality indicators.
Sharjah is a cultural and educational hub, recognized by UNESCO, offering a rich heritage and a family-friendly environment.
Drawbacks
Sharjah experiences high car dependency, with over 83% of commuters using cars, leading to significant traffic congestion.
The city's walkability score is moderate at 68, indicating that some errands require a car.
Summers are very hot and arid, with average temperatures often exceeding 30-35°C, which can be challenging for outdoor activities.
Specific data for certain city-level metrics like median age and unemployment rate are not readily available, often requiring reliance on broader UAE national data.
While public transport exists, the high car dependency suggests that the public transit network may not be as comprehensive or preferred as private vehicles.
Rexburg
Advantages
Low crime rates contribute to a high safety score and a family-friendly environment.
Affordable cost of living, particularly for housing and daily expenses, compared to national averages.
Strong sense of community and family-oriented atmosphere, enhanced by the presence of BYU-Idaho.
Abundant outdoor recreational opportunities, with proximity to national parks like Yellowstone and Grand Teton.
Short average commute times, making daily travel more efficient.
Drawbacks
Limited nightlife and entertainment options, characteristic of a smaller, quieter town.
Harsh winters with significant snowfall and cold temperatures impact daily activities.
Housing market can be competitive, with desirable properties selling quickly.
Car dependency is high due to limited public transit options.
The median age is very low (21), indicating a strong student population which may influence the city's overall social dynamic.
